What's Happening?
OpenAI recently faced a significant security challenge with the emergence of ShadowLeak, a zero-click exploit targeting its ChatGPT platform. This exploit allowed advanced social engineering techniques to bypass the usual safety restrictions, posing a threat to both individual and organizational privacy. OpenAI responded promptly by patching the vulnerability, highlighting the importance of robust security measures in AI systems. The incident underscores the potential risks associated with AI integrations, particularly concerning privacy and data protection.
